ソースコードのバージョン管理システムはソフトウェア開発に欠かせないツールです。本稿では前編から引き続き,GitベースのBitbucket Server(以降,Bitbucket)を取り上げます。
技術評論社の書籍・雑誌公式サイト、gihyo.jpに掲載されました。ソフトウェア開発で避けることのできない不具合対応やトラブル対応において、ソースコードの作業履歴に残されている情報が問題解決に重要な役割を果たします。肝心なのはその“残し方”です。
技術評論社の書籍・雑誌公式サイト、gihyo.jpに掲載されました。
ソフトウェア開発で避けることのできない不具合対応やトラブル対応において,JiraやBitbucket Serverをどのように活用していくかについて説明します。
技術評論社の書籍・雑誌公式サイト、gihyo.jpに掲載されました。サポートツールを加えたバージョン管理システムとプロジェクト管理システムの連携によって実装作業がどのように効率化されるかを実際に少人数のアジャイル開発を行っている現場の開発作業の実例を交えて説明します。
技術評論社の書籍・雑誌公式サイト、gihyo.jpに掲載されました。今回は、ソースコード管理・バージョン管理について説明します。
GitHub EnterpriseからStashへ移行した理由は「安定性」と「アカウント管理」「権限管理」だった。
海外拠点や社外エンジニアも利用するからこそ必要な「アカウント管理」「権限管理」をStashは満たしていた。
技術評論社の書籍・雑誌公式サイト、gihyo.jpに掲載されました。
Stashを選んだ理由と運用面のポイント
「GitHub Enterprise」と「GitLab」との検討の結果、コスト面のメリット、ツール連携のしやすさなどからStashを選択。
技術評論社の書籍・雑誌公式サイト、gihyo.jpに掲載されました。
開発チームを悩ませた「不確実性」に対しての対応/情報共有基盤がなくチームごとにツールが乱立などの課題。
解決はコミュニケーション基盤や開発基盤を標準化し,開発生産性を上げるための「Jira」や「Confluence」「Stash」「HipChat」を導入。
技術評論社の書籍・雑誌公式サイト、gihyo.jpに掲載されました。